    307: Bonus Ep: Diving Into The Stephen King Archives with Professor Caroline Bicks

    2026-05-08 | 1h 2 mins.
    University of Maine Professor (and the Stephen E. King Chair in Literature, by the way) Caroline Bicks spent a year combing through King's original manuscripts at his own personal archive and that resulted in an essential book for King obsessives: Monsters In The Archives that gives us new insights into King's process and illuminates paths not taken on some of his most iconic stories, like The Shining, Pet Sematary, Carrie, Night Shift, and 'Salem's Lot.

    306: Joe Hill's King Sorrow with Jeremy Slater

    2026-05-06 | 1h 19 mins.
    Screenwriter Jeremy Slater (Moon Knight, The Exorcist, Mortal Kombat II) returns to The Kingcast to talk about... not Stephen King. Well, not directly, anyway. The topic up for discussion is Joe Hill's 2025 epic horror tome King Sorrow which contains many familial references and those don't just include his famous father. 
    The story centers a group of college friends who uncover the ability to summon a dark force to combat their enemies, but like most dark forces this protection comes at a price.Hill tells this story over multiple decades and litters the narrative with nods to many King titles, from The Dead Zone to The Dark Tower.
